Chicken pox treatmemt
I am 47 years, weight 76 kg. I've developed chicken pox and blisters have come out all over the body, starting from the abdomen.I cannot go out and consult a doctor. What shall I do now, to cure it? What precautions do I need to take.Can I take bath? Is there any restriction on my diet as long as this us not fully cured.

Hello.... Chicken pox is self subsiding viral infection..  One can treat it symtomatically..  There is not medicine to cure this infection..  Symptoms  will  be there for a week  or so depending on individual immunity..  It can lead to complication if elders affected with this infection....
Health Tips
avoid oily  foods,  you can take bath..  take PCT if you have fever..
